What other jobs might you be interested in if you weren't so busy writing music?

Stewart Wallace

I'd make things with my hands like a sculptor or a painter. Things that I could touch. Things that would be done when I was done. Where the thing was the thing itself - not a roadmap to be interpreted, not dependent on the skills of the interpreter. Or maybe I'd be an architect. With building codes and zoning laws and construction workers and corporate patrons, this seems to me even more of a headache than being a composer writing an opera.

[Ed. Note: Stewart Wallace just completed his first ballet, a three act version of Peter Pan with choreography by Graham Lustig, which will premiere in Dallas TX at the Fairpark Music Hall on April 21, 2000 at 8:00 PM. There will be additional performances in Dallas on April 22 at 2:00 and 8:00 PM, and in Fort Worth TX at the Bass Performance Hall on May 5 at 8:00 PM, May 6 at 2:00 and 8:00 PM, and May 7 (Mother's Day) at 2:00 PM.]
